The Clover School District Board of Trustees will hold a special meeting on Monday, August 1, at 6:00 p.m. to consider approval of a bond resolution for the November ballot.
The Board of Trustees met for a work session on Wednesday, July 13, to build consensus around the resolution. Board members expressed their interest in constructing a new high school with a capacity for 2,100 students. The proposed new high school would be built on the parcel of land already owned by the district on Daimler Boulevard.
The Board also will consider whether a stadium for the proposed school will be included in the primary ballot question or as a second question.
The meeting will be held at the District Office, located at 604 Bethel Street in Clover. Public forum will be available for members of the community to share their views on the proposed bond referendum.
